Immerse yourself in the timeless elegance of Johann Sebastian Bach's "Bach: 6 Flute Sonatas," a masterful collection of chamber music that showcases the composer's unparalleled genius. Released on Hyperion in January 2013, this album presents a captivating journey through six distinct flute sonatas, each a testament to Bach's extraordinary compositional skill and versatility.
The sonatas are divided into two groups of three, each offering a unique blend of styles and moods. The first three sonatas feature a concertante keyboard part, where the right hand plays a prominent role, creating a dynamic interplay with the flute. The remaining three sonatas are equally engaging, showcasing Bach's ability to craft intricate and expressive melodies that resonate with listeners.
Performed by renowned musicians Andrea Oliva on flute and Angela Hewitt on piano, this recording captures the essence of Bach's music with remarkable precision and artistry. The album spans a total duration of 77 minutes and 48 seconds, providing a comprehensive exploration of Bach's flute sonatas.
From the lively "Allegro moderato" of the Flute Sonata in E-Flat Major, BWV 1031, to the soothing "Adagio" of the Flute Sonata in G Minor, BWV 1020, each track offers a unique listening experience. The album also includes the enchanting "Siciliano" from the Flute Sonata in E Major, BWV 1035, and the spirited "Presto – Allegro" of the Flute Sonata in B Minor, BWV 1030.
